Transaction dcadc666ea39a3c177ef8d23899e2bdd644dbb5058e408d96d18e6b024b7e0ff
1 Input
1 Output
-
dcadc666ea39a3c177ef8d23899e2bdd644dbb5058e408d96d18e6b024b7e0ff:0
- value
- 12099842
- script pubkey
- OP_0 OP_PUSHBYTES_20 46311e5eae757f3823d9bc4c55f2fe319643fab4
- address
- bc1qgcc3uh4ww4lnsg7eh3x9tuh7xxty8745fpc2eh